DocumentCode
573525
Title
Scientific SPARQL: Semantic Web Queries over Scientific Data
Author
Andrejev, Andrej ; Risch, Tore
Author_Institution
Dept. of Inf. Technol., Uppsala Univ., Uppsala, Sweden
fYear
2012
fDate
1-5 April 2012
Firstpage
5
Lastpage
10
Abstract
We define an extended version of the Semantic Web query language SPARQL called Scientific SPARQL, SciSPARQL. It is targeted mainly at scientific computing and laboratory data management. SciSPARQL includes expressions, numeric multi-dimensional array operations, user-defined functions, aggregate functions, and function views. A prototype system translates SciSPARQL to a Datalog dialect which is extensible by external functions implemented in a regular programming language. The system automatically recognizes collections in RDF Turtle statements that represent numerical multi-dimensional arrays in order to represent them with a special native data type. A back-end relational database provides persistent storage.
Keywords
query languages; semantic Web; SciSPARQL; aggregate function; backend relational database; datalog dialect; function views; laboratory data management; numeric multidimensional array operation; numerical multidimensional arrays; regular programming language; scientific SPARQL; scientific data; semantic Web queries; semantic Web query language SPARQL; Aggregates; Arrays; Database languages; Relational databases; Resource description framework; Semantics; Trajectory;
fLanguage
English
Publisher
ieee
Conference_Titel
Data Engineering Workshops (ICDEW), 2012 IEEE 28th International Conference on
Conference_Location
Arlington, VA
Print_ISBN
978-1-4673-1640-8
Type
conf
DOI
10.1109/ICDEW.2012.67
Filename
6313648
Link To Document